社区
C#
帖子详情
请问谁知道什么时候使用反射啊?我会使用反射调用类的方法,属性.但是这样有必要吗?请指教
宰恩灬威廉姆斯
2004-08-31 04:19:20
请问谁知道什么时候使用反射啊?我会使用反射调用类的方法,属性.但是这样有必要吗?请指教
...全文
444
6
打赏
收藏
请问谁知道什么时候使用反射啊?我会使用反射调用类的方法,属性.但是这样有必要吗?请指教
请问谁知道什么时候使用反射啊?我会使用反射调用类的方法,属性.但是这样有必要吗?请指教
复制链接
扫一扫
分享
转发到动态
举报
写回复
配置赞助广告
用AI写文章
6 条
回复
切换为时间正序
请发表友善的回复…
发表回复
打赏红包
nocolor
2004-09-13
打赏
举报
回复
上csdn上找找看.
宰恩灬威廉姆斯
2004-09-13
打赏
举报
回复
反射主要是使用迟榜定,不过我认为并不会节省内存。而且不知道迟榜定有什么优势实在。有没有高手说具体一点。
8789
2004-09-01
打赏
举报
回复
看一下设计模式,会对你有帮助的
khpcg
2004-09-01
打赏
举报
回复
agree to thinkingforever(努力学习)
zfwdf
2004-08-31
打赏
举报
回复
不知道,没有用过,帮忙顶一下!
thinkingforever
2004-08-31
打赏
举报
回复
反射提供了封装程序集、模块和类型的对象。您可以使用反射动态地创建类型的实例,将类型绑定到现有对象,或从现有对象中获取类型。然后,可以调用类型的方法或访问其字段和属性。
需要动态加载时使用,这样可以节省内存空间.
关于java一个
类
(A)继承另一个
类
(B),在A中
调用
B的
属性
或
方法
或在其他
类
中创建一个A的对象
调用
A的
属性
,报错Type The field Item.name is visible。
1、调试程序说明: 编写
类
A(Armor)继承
类
B(Item)的
属性
,并在A
类
中创建A的对象
调用
B
类
的
属性
以及A自己的
属性
。
类
B:
类
A: 2、问题说明、解决: 1、在
类
A中
调用
name的过程中发现报错Type The field Item.name is visible,原因在于两个
类
不在同一个包中不能
调用
,要求父
类
的
属性
为public,子
类
的对象才能够通过 **“.
属性
”**进行
调用
并赋...
java
反射
调用
方法
参数_Java
类
用
反射
机制来
调用
带参数的
方法
碰到的一些问题...
Java
类
用
反射
机制来
调用
带参数的
方法
碰到的一些问题关注:216答案:2mip版解决时间 2021-02-11 02:55提问者負袮、叕哬妨2021-02-10 14:45JSP在MVC模式下,前台每次
请
求到一个Servlet时,request对象中都带上一个表示跳转动作的
属性
action,servlet根据这个action的值来
调用
相应的
方法
。其中,action的值和
方法
的名字是一样的,...
Kotlin专题「二十五」:
反射
前言:不要在夕阳西下时幻想,要在旭日东升时努力。 一、概述
反射
机制是在运行状态中,对于任意一个
类
,都能
知道
这个
类
的所有
方法
和
属性
;对于任意一个对象,都能
调用
它的任意一个
方法
和
属性
,这种动态获取的信息以及动态
调用
对象的
方法
的功能称为 Java 语言的
反射
机制当在 Kotlin 中
使用
反射
时,你可能会
使用
到两种不同的
反射
API。第一种是标准的 **Java
反射
**,定义在包 **java.lang.reflect** 中,因为 Kotlin
类
会被编译成普通的 Java 字节码,Java
反射
AP
java
反射
底层原理。
Java
反射
机制是java的这门语言所独有的,这也是面试官喜欢问的知识点之一,我们不能仅仅从会
使用
反射
这个
类
以及
类
中
方法
,来认定自己会这个知识点,我认为这太过于表面,不是我们学习java的正确的方式。 首先我们先了解
反射
的相关概念:
反射
是指java运行状态中,任何
类
都能
知道
当前
类
的
属性
和
方法
,任何对象都能
调用
当前对象的
属性
和
方法
(前提是非私有
属性
)。 我们首先来看一个例子: package com...
反射
中获取成员变量值和执行
方法
时为什么需要传参对象
接触学习java
反射
时,相信不少的同学会有一个疑问【为什么获取成员变量值需要传递一个对象呢?】。 用一个非常普通的Student
类
来做实例 我们大多都
知道
,通过getFiled(指定获取的变量名称) 就可以得到了相对应的Filed成员变量对象, 包含着
类
全名以及变量名称!!! 那么问题来了,为什么获取成员变量的值就需要传入一个对象呢??? 我们不是已经获取了Filed...
C#
111,125
社区成员
642,540
社区内容
发帖
与我相关
我的任务
C#
.NET技术 C#
复制链接
扫一扫
分享
社区描述
.NET技术 C#
社区管理员
加入社区
获取链接或二维码
近7日
近30日
至今
加载中
查看更多榜单
社区公告
让您成为最强悍的C#开发者
试试用AI创作助手写篇文章吧
+ 用AI写文章